Isn't the beerotor FC an F3 too? In which case, i wouldn't see a reason to buy a new flight controller. You could still flash iNav on it... and actually the chip wouldn't even matter that much, stuff should still work even on F1 boards.


PS: Forgot to say, i only recently noticed, the roll/pitch acc trim can be changed in GUI, no need to go into CLI for that... my fault. Smile

(30-May-2017, 01:52 AM)Hank Deucker Wrote: I attempted to flash the BeeRotor F3 with iNav, but I have had no success. Reading indicates that one has to use Zadig to set it up but unfortunately I use an iMac so I dip out on that one. If anyone can help it would be appreciated.

I don't know where you read that, but it's not correct.

Like many older F3 based boards, the BeeRotor F3 uses the CP2102 UART - USB bridge chip and does not implement DFU mode for flashing.

So, if your Mac is already able to talk to the BRF3 with the Betaflight configurator, then flashing with the iNav configurator should be as simple as:

With the BFR3 disconnected, load the iNav configurator, go to the firmware flasher and select the SP Racing F3 firmware.
Set 'Full Chip Erase', 'No Reboot Sequence' and set 'Manual Baud Rate' to 256000.
Hold down the boot button while you connect the USB cable and then click 'Flash Firmware'.

Done!

Glad to hear it!

Flashing flight controllers and connecting to them is so much easier on Mac or Linux as they don't handle drivers and devices in the same brain dead way that Windows does. I've never had to install any third party drivers on my Linux powered computers to get them to flash either via DFU or a CP2102 bridge. All I needed to do was tell the udev daemon how to recognise them and how the corresponding device file should be created. Then tell the modem manager to leave these particular devices alone and not try to probe them and see if they have a modem attached.

That's a one time job and it doesn't forget what I tell it and start screwing things up every time I install updates.
